ENAEX BRASIL PRESENT IN THE MAIN MINING EVENTS OF THE COUNTRY

Enaex Brasil has intensified its participation in the most relevant events of the mining sector, consolidating its strategic presence and approaching clients and specialists in spaces of knowledge exchange.

 

Between August 26 and 28, the company participated in the 12th edition of the Brazilian Congress of Open Pit and Underground Mining (CBMINA), held in Ouro Preto (MG) and organized by IBRAM. In one of the main panels, Enaex Brasil presented innovations in rock blasting and the Quality Assurance and Quality Control Program (QA/QC) applied in Vale’s iron ore mine in Carajás (PA), highlighting the use of BlastScout Probe technology as a key tool to improve efficiency and operational safety.

 

In September, the company had an active presence at Blastech, in São Paulo, where it presented use cases of BlastScout Radar integrated to the Scan module of the Enaex Bright digital platform. It also had its own stand that allowed it to strengthen links with industry players and share experiences.

 

The company’s agenda will continue in October, when it will participate in Exposibram, in Salvador, considered one of the most important mining meetings in Latin America.

ENAEX AFRICA CELEBRATES WOMEN'S MONTH WITH A HIGH TEA

Last August 22nd, the women of Enaex Africa gathered at different points of the company to commemorate Women’s Month with a High Tea celebration. The purpose of the meeting was to recognize and highlight the fundamental role that women play in the construction of Enaex and in society.

 

The event was inaugurated by Phumzile Buthelezi, Director of People and Sustainability, who gave words of encouragement and gratitude to the employees for their daily contribution in supporting, empowering and strengthening other women within the organization.

 

The program included the participation of a guest speaker and a makeup workshop, creating a space for inspiration, learning and connection among the attendees.

 

In South Africa, Women’s Month has a deep historical significance, as it commemorates the 1956 March in which more than 20,000 women protested united against injustice. Today, this date symbolizes the progress achieved, but also the pending challenges in terms of equality.

 

With this activity, Enaex reaffirmed its commitment to promote an inclusive environment where women can develop and prosper.

ENAEX BRASIL AMONG THE MOST INNOVATIVE IN THE COUNTRY

At Enaex Brasil, innovation is not an option: it is a value. This commitment was recognized in the Prêmio Valor Inovação Brasil 2025, in which the Brazilian branch obtained the 3rd place in the chemical sector and stood out among the 50 most innovative companies in the country.

 

The result reflects the strength of the company, as well as the innovation and entrepreneurial spirit that guide its teams, inspire solutions and drive the transformation of the mining and chemical industry. The company consistently invests in electronics, digitalization, robotics and industrial automation, strengthening operational excellence and adding value to the entire production chain.

 

Being next to global references and client-partners such as Vale and Gerdau confirms the consolidation of Enaex as a reference in innovation and strengthens ties with companies that share the same values.

 

The Prêmio Valor Inovação Brasil, conducted by Strategy& (PwC’s strategic consulting firm) and the Valor Econômico newspaper, is the most relevant innovation publication in the country, which recognizes companies that stand out for their capacity to innovate in their sectors.
